We currently offer a choice of two ISAs: the NFU Mutual Stocks and Shares ISA is a stocks and shares ISA that gives access to unit linked investment funds. Our Shrewd Savings Plan ISA is also a stocks and shares ISA, but it is With-Profits based rather than unit linked.
On this page you will find information about the NFU Mutual Stocks and Shares ISA. Find out more about our Shrewd Savings Plan ISA.
The NFU Mutual Stocks and Shares ISA invests in the NFU Mutual OEIC and aims to achieve medium to long term capital growth, designed to be held for 5 years or more. There is a range of funds available to give you the flexibility of spreading your investment risk. The Stocks and Shares ISA allows you to benefit from the potential for tax efficient income, growth or a combination of both.
This means that, unlike many other types of saving and investment, you do not have to pay personal tax on any profit you make, or even declare this on your tax return.

In the 2011/2012 tax year, the total annual ISA allowance has increased to £10,680 which can be invested as follows:
| Stocks and shares | Up to £10,680 less the amount of any money deposited in a cash ISA |
| Cash | Up to £5,340 |
| Overall maximum investment | £10,680 |
The annual ISA allowance will be linked to the rise in inflation (measured by the Consumer Price Index) each year. In the event of a negative inflation figure, the allowance will be frozen.
You can invest from as little as £25 a month or £1,000 lump sum. You will have a choice of different funds in which to invest (subject to minimum investments per fund), depending on your investment objectives. The available funds include a choice of 'Managed' funds as well as a range of more focused 'Market' funds. These are explained in the 'frequently asked questions' section.
Investments in the NFU Mutual OEIC are managed by NFU Mutual's investment team, who choose which stocks to invest in. Their philosophy is always to balance potential returns without taking unnecessary risk. In other words they aim to generate long-term growth rather than speculative short term gains for investors.
